Mission: Impossible is a hit with fans for its consistent delivery of innovative action sequences and daring stunts, all anchored by Tom Cruise's charismatic performance. Each film ups the ante with its breathtaking set pieces, making it a thrilling ride from start to finish.
The Godfather trilogy resonates deeply with fans due to its powerful storytelling and memorable characters. The emotional depth and the transformation of Michael Corleone from reluctant outsider to ruthless mob boss offers a gripping narrative that has stood the test of time.
